What companies run services between Cergy-Pontoise, France and Gennevilliers, France?
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F) operates a train from Pontoise to Gennevilliers every 30 minutes. Tickets cost €3–8 and the journey takes 30 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Gare de Cergy Préfecture - Quai I to Rond-Point Pierre Timbaud via Gare d'Argenteuil in around 1h 45m.
